Annette Anderson
September 29, 1925 - March 31, 2016

Annette Alice Anderson, age 90, was surrounded by her family as she quietly and peacefully ascended into the presence of her Creator and Redeemer on Thursday, March 31, 2016.

The youngest of eight children, Annette Alice Carlson was born on September 29, 1925, to Henning and Esther Danielson Carlson. She attended country school through the 8th grade and graduated from Albert City High School in 1942. After receiving her teaching certificate in 1944 from Buena Vista College, she taught at Fairview Country School for two years.

Annette trusted Christ as her personal Savior while attending Bible camp at Okoboji. She was a current member of the Evangelical Free Church in Albert City where she served as Sunday school teacher, choir member, and with the WMS ministry. Glorifying God with her life was of the utmost importance to Annette.

On May 29th, 1946, Annette married Virgil Winten Anderson of Laurel, Nebraska. To their union, five children were born: Douglas Virgil, Janeen Annette, Janet Esther, Donna Lillie, and Dorie LaVonne.

Annette loved to sew and make beautiful flower arrangements, skills which proved a great help for her daughters' and granddaughters' weddings, showers and graduations. In addition, she worked as a bookkeeper for Anderson Auto.

Virgil and Annette loved to go camping. They started camping in a converted school bus, which they shared with Annette’s sister Ila’s family. Then, they had a homemade camper which Virgil and Howard DeYoung built before eventually acquiring a modern camper. Their trips took them to many states. Their favorite vacation destinations were Colorado, South Dakota, and Texas.
